Bitumen Road Laying: Techniques and Best Standards
The process of tarmacadam road material requires careful planning and adherence to recommended methods . Typically , the work begins with proper site leveling, including the removal of existing material and the compaction of the sub-base. Base course layers are then laid and compacted to ensure a stable foundation. The tarmacadam compound itself – a combination of aggregate and bitumen – is warmed to the correct temperature before being distributed and smoothed in even thicknesses . High control checks throughout the project are essential to guarantee a long-lasting and dependable road covering. Best practices also stress proper drainage and the use of appropriate machinery for timely delivery and lifespan of the road.

Eco-Friendly Tarmacadam Surfacing Choices
The growing need for sustainable construction methods is driving innovation in road construction. Traditional tarmacadam, while robust , often relies on energy-heavy processes . Thankfully, multiple innovative solutions are arising that considerably minimize the ecological effect. These include :
- Recycled Asphalt Material : Utilizing discarded asphalt from old roads.
- Filtered Pavement: Allowing rainfall to drain through, minimizing runoff and recharging groundwater.
- Bio-based Binders: Replacing petroleum-based bitumen with compounds from sustainable sources .
- Low-carbon Concrete Compositions: Incorporating waste components to lower cement content, a major contributor to emissions
